Comparison of the retention behavior of β-blockers using immobilized artificial membrane chromatography and lysophospholipid micellar electrokinetic chromatography

摘要
We have demonstrated that significant differences exist between the retention of eight beta-blockers analyzed with immobilized artificial membrane (IAM) and lysophospholipid micellar electrokinetic capillary (LMEKC) chromatographic methods. The general retention trends are maintained with highly hydrophilic compounds such as atenolol eluting first and more hydrophobic compounds such as propranolol eluting last. The retention order, however, is different and would result in major ranking differences. LMEKC demonstrates a better correlation with liposomal partitioning (R-2=0.95) than does IAM chromatography (R-2=0.60). LMEKC, with its higher efficiency, can allow a more specific evaluation of lipophilicity than IAM chromatography and is useful in the analysis of pharmaceutical candidates, particularly for ranking purposes.
